New folks: Spokeline predicts dock shortages and dispatches van routes for the Harwick bike-share network. Cron runs every 15 min; config in `rebalancer.toml`. Known issues: the solver times out on holidays (bump the limit), and dock capacities in the Westport zone are stale. Deploys go through the Ferrule pipeline; don't push Fridays. Ops dashboards cover the rest. One critical thing: the admin vault holding dispatch credentials locks after 30 days idle, and reopening it needs the recovery passphrase given below.

unlock words, hahip-baduf: holwyn-istath-julvan

Heads-up for plugin authors: the bloom filter sitting in front of Hollowbyte's Kegstore KV layer is vendored from Siftware, so don't fork or patch it inside your plugins. False-positive tuning happens upstream, and Siftware pushes config updates through our monthly bundle. If your plugin sees weird miss rates, it's almost always a stale filter snapshot — re-sync before filing anything. For licensing questions or to report filter anomalies, write to Siftware's partner inbox.

escalation mailbox, bafog-fafog: ulador@paliqlabs.internal

Maintainers: Coppervane conversion rounding bugs recur in two places. One, the promo discount path converts before discounting; it must discount first, then convert once. Two, the reconciliation job compares floats instead of minor units — any diff under 0.005 is noise, ignore it. Store integers in minor units, convert at the edge, round half-even. Never patch amounts directly in the ledger; file a correction entry instead. Historical incidents and the correction-entry procedure are recorded on the internal page below.

runbook for tajep-yahig: https://artifactory.lumictech.corp/repo

Ticket BF-2218: The nightly backfill scheduler on Driftmark has been failing since Monday because its credential for the internal warehouse ingestion service expired. All backfill runs are queued, not lost, and will replay once auth succeeds. Please update the scheduler's environment configuration and restart the worker pool. The replacement key for the ingestion service is provided below.

app token of badug-tahaf = qvz11-nP5FBNr8qnh